AIESEC Azerbaijan Presents International Programs at BSU

18/11/2025

The international youth organization AIESEC Azerbaijan held an information session for students at Baku State University (BSU).

Ramin Samedov, Head of the Department of Humanitarian Affairs and Youth Policy at BSU, emphasized that the projects implemented by AIESEC Azerbaijan play an important role in the personal and professional development of young people.

Nazenin Mammadli, Chair of the Marketing and Public Relations Committee of AIESEC Azerbaijan, informed students about the organization’s activities, international programs, and membership process. She noted that AIESEC’s volunteering opportunities abroad, paid internships, and leadership development programs offer students valuable chances to gain personal growth, discover new cultures, and build a global network.

The session continued with interactive discussions.

It should be noted that AIESEC operates in approximately 130 countries worldwide. AIESEC Azerbaijan has been active since 2006. The organization’s primary mission is to unlock the leadership potential of young people, support their development, and provide opportunities to gain international experience through various global programs.
